Handover Note — Logistics Provider Transition
To: Incoming Director of Operations, Fennigale Traders
From: Outgoing Director

We are mid-transition from Calbright Freight to Norwell Carriage. Contracts are signed; pilot lanes from the Eastport depot begin next month. Watch the cold-chain clauses closely — Calbright's exit terms require careful sequencing. One confidential planning matter follows directly below.

board note of bawep-tajef: Queniusek Systems plans to raise the Quenvan list price by 53.1 percent in March. The pricing group signed off on a budget of $176.4 million for Project Drueth. The renewal with Casionix Partners closes at $142.5 million a year, 8.3 percent below the last contract. Project Fraax slips by six weeks because of the tooling delay.

**Q: How does the AgriLink gateway handle telemetry from tractors that drop offline mid-field?**

A: Good question — this trips up every reviewer. The gateway buffers up to 48 hours of readings locally on the Harrowfen edge unit, signs each batch, and replays it once connectivity returns. Replayed batches are timestamped at capture, not upload, so don't flag the clock skew as tampering. If you need to inspect a sealed buffer during your review, you'll need the recovery passphrase, shown just below.

unlock words, yawig-kagef: gordor-holvan-ulaael-pramir-ulaiel-tamdor

## Authentication

Marrowtide hot-reloads its auth configuration every 30 seconds, so token scopes and issuer settings can change without a restart. Reload events are logged at INFO with a config checksum; verify the checksum matches before assuming new scopes apply. During reloads, in-flight requests keep the prior config. The watcher itself authenticates to the internal Keyloft service with the key below.

gateway credential: kto23_LX9A4ys6i4nzHtpOLNLodKK

## Graphloom Environments

Welcome aboard! Graphloom (our dependency graph visualizer) runs in three environments: dev, staging, and prod. Dev is a free-for-all, staging mirrors prod data nightly, and prod is deploy-by-approval only. You'll mostly live in staging while ramping up. Renders can take a minute on big graphs — grab coffee. The staging instance currently runs with the configuration below.

deployment values, kagep-bawep:
ulaeth:
  pin: 3932
  tenant: praeth
  seal: seal_f2266d4e
  metrics_host: metrics.ulaeth.ferrasys.local
  standby_team: brivan
  escalation: ulaius-tamix
  nonce: a28b66